2016年4月7日 · Here in Singapore, pea shoots (da dou miao) are seasonally available compared to pea sprouts (xiao dou miao).But when in season, it’s easy to buy these from the wet markets. I’ve been told by the vegetable vendors that large dou miao are sourced mainly from Taiwan.. Given their seasonality, I tend to buy in large quantities, about 500 grams to 750 gm.

2017年4月13日 · Select Dou Miao with short stems and thick leaves. If the stems are long and skinny, they are usually very fibrous. You can break the stem to test if they snap easily. If not, they are usually tough and fibrous. Do not keep the Dou Miao in the fridge for more than 2 days. Otherwise, it will age and turn fibrous.

豌豆苗,豌豆的嫩茎叶,也是苗类蔬菜的一种,又被称为“豌豆尖”、“龙须菜”、“龙须苗”,是以蔬菜豌豆的幼嫩茎叶、嫩梢作为食用的一种绿叶菜。在南方特别是江南地区最受欢迎,扬州人在岁首的餐桌上必摆上一盘豌豆苗,以表岁岁平安之意。豌豆苗营养丰富,含有多种人体必需的氨基酸。

Dou Miao - Flavor and Fortune
Dou miao or pea shoots, like many Asian vegetables, go by a confusing number of names. Some people call them 'pea vines' others say 'pea tips,' still others call them 'pea stems.' Because they are the tender tips of the edible pea plant--the top several leaves and the tendril that ends the vine, different names are used.
